A Clockwork Orange
“A nasty little shocker” was how the TLS described A Clockwork Orange when it was published in 1962. Gmail
People in Iran can apparently once again access their Gmail accounts after the service was blocked last week. Xbox 360
At last, the Xbox 360 Gamerscore is no longer just for show. Microsoft’s (MSFT) Xbox Live Rewards program is now giving gamers special perks for having higher Gamerscores.
